Skip to content

Missing Testing Documentation #193

@Lynndabel

Description

@Lynndabel

Priority: 🟡 Medium
Files: Testing guides, quality assurance documentation
Detailed Issue: No comprehensive testing documentation covering unit tests, integration tests, end-to-end tests, and quality assurance procedures.

Testing Documentation Gaps:

  • Testing Strategy: No documented testing approach and methodology
  • Test Coverage: No guidelines for test coverage requirements
  • Test Data: No test data management and generation procedures
  • Automation: No automated testing pipeline documentation
  • Quality Gates: No quality criteria and release procedures

Development Impact:

  • Inconsistent Testing: Different developers use different testing approaches
  • Quality Variations: Inconsistent code quality across components
  • Regression Issues: Undiscovered regressions due to incomplete testing
  • Release Risks: Releases without proper quality validation
  • Technical Debt: Accumulation of untested code and components

Quality Assurance Challenges:

  • Test Coverage Gaps: Critical functionality goes untested
  • Test Maintenance: Tests become outdated without proper documentation
  • Performance Issues: No performance testing procedures
  • Security Testing: No security testing guidelines and procedures
  • Integration Testing: Poor integration test coverage

Required Documentation:

  • Comprehensive testing strategy and methodology
  • Test coverage requirements and guidelines
  • Test data management and generation procedures
  • Automated testing pipeline configuration
  • Quality gates and release criteria
  • Performance testing procedures and benchmarks
  • Security testing guidelines and checklists
  • Integration testing procedures and scenarios

Testing Levels to Document:

  • Unit Testing: Component-level testing procedures
  • Integration Testing: System integration testing procedures
  • End-to-End Testing: Full workflow testing procedures
  • Performance Testing: Load and stress testing procedures
  • Security Testing: Security vulnerability testing procedures

Labels: documentation, testing, quality-assurance, development, reliability


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ions